Have you ever needed to track down a lost or missing tax refund from the IRS? If so, you may need to fill out IRS Form 3911. This form is used to request a trace of your refund to see where it may have gone astray.
Form 3911 is a straightforward document that requires basic information such as your Social Security number, filing status, and the amount of the missing refund. Once completed, you’ll need to send it to the correct IRS address to begin the trace process.

When sending IRS Form 3911, it’s crucial to mail it to the correct address to ensure that your request is processed promptly. The address you need to send the form to depends on where you live and the type of return you filed.
For individuals filing Form 1040, you can find the correct address to send Form 3911 on the IRS website. Make sure to double-check the address before sending your form to avoid any delays in processing your request.
If you’re unsure of where to send IRS Form 3911, you can always contact the IRS directly for assistance. They will be able to provide you with the correct address based on your specific circumstances.
